Composition and distribution characteristics of the eukaryotic community in seawater and saline-alkali water ponds and their correlation with the nutritional components of Scylla Paramamosain
We examined the correlations between the nutritional components of Mud crab Scylla paramamosain and the variation of eukaryotic communities in two types of aquaculture ponds in north China.
